{"id":5893,"date":"2019-07-03T09:33:25","date_gmt":"2019-07-03T07:33:25","guid":{"rendered":"https:\/\/blog.generationrobots.com\/?p=5893"},"modified":"2023-03-29T10:40:34","modified_gmt":"2023-03-29T08:40:34","slug":"comment-programmer-des-lego-mindstorms-ev3-avec-scratch-3","status":"publish","type":"post","link":"https:\/\/www.generationrobots.com\/blog\/fr\/comment-programmer-des-lego-mindstorms-ev3-avec-scratch-3\/","title":{"rendered":"Comment programmer des Lego Mindstorms EV3 avec Scratch 3 ?"},"content":{"rendered":"\n<p>Dans ce tutoriel, vous apprendrez comment programmer vos Lego Mindstorms avec le logiciel Scratch 3. Il est \u00e9galement possible d\u2019utiliser Scratch 3 avec les Lego Boost et les Lego WeDo.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"h-prerequis-a-l-utilisation-de-scratch-3-avec-lego-mindstorms-les-logiciels\">Pr\u00e9requis \u00e0 l\u2019utilisation de Scratch 3 avec Lego Mindstorms : les logiciels<\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Le syst\u00e8me d\u2019exploitation de votre ordinateur doit \u00eatre <a class=\"catalogue\" title=\"Passez de Windows 8 \u00e0 Windows 10\" href=\"https:\/\/support.microsoft.com\/fr-fr\/help\/12435\/windows-10-upgrade-faq\" target=\"_blank\" rel=\"noopener noreferrer\">Windows 10<\/a> version 16299.0 ou sup\u00e9rieure.<\/li>\n\n\n\n<li>Pour les utilisateurs de Mac, vous devez \u00eatre \u00e9quip\u00e9 de <a class=\"catalogue\" title=\"macOS 10.10 (Yosemite) pour Mac\" href=\"https:\/\/www.apple.com\/fr\/osx\/apps\/app-store\/\" target=\"_blank\" rel=\"noopener noreferrer\">macOS 10.10 (Yosemite)<\/a><\/li>\n\n\n\n<li>Il faut ensuite t\u00e9l\u00e9charger et installer Scratch Link, un programme gratuit qui permet \u00e0 Scratch 3 de se connecter avec des objets du monde r\u00e9el, comme des robots ou des Lego. Vous pouvez t\u00e9l\u00e9charger directement Scratch Link pour Mac et Windows depuis le site officiel de Scratch (MIT).<\/li>\n\n\n\n<li>Une connexion internet est \u00e9galement un pr\u00e9requis pour utiliser Scratch 3, qui est ex\u00e9cut\u00e9 dans un navigateur web.<\/li>\n\n\n\n<li>Vous aurez bien s\u00fbr \u00e9galement besoin d\u2019un kit Lego Mindstorms EV3 (pour les enseignants, nous recommandons le kit Lego Mindstorms EV3 \u00ab Education \u00bb).<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\" id=\"h-prerequis-a-l-utilisation-de-scratch-3-avec-lego-mindstorms-le-bluetooth\">Pr\u00e9requis \u00e0 l\u2019utilisation de Scratch 3 avec Lego Mindstorms : le bluetooth<\/h2>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"h-activez-le-bluetooth-sur-votre-ordinateur\">Activez le Bluetooth sur votre ordinateur<\/h3>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Activez la fonctionnalit\u00e9 Bluetooth de votre ordinateur (s\u2019il poss\u00e8de une puce Bluetooth int\u00e9gr\u00e9e).<\/li>\n\n\n\n<li>Si votre ordinateur n\u2019embarque pas de puce Bluetooth, il vous suffit de connecter un dongle Bluetooth sur un de ses ports USB. Les pilotes de ce nouveau p\u00e9riph\u00e9rique s\u2019installeront automatiquement, vous n\u2019aurez normalement rien \u00e0 faire d\u2019autre que de le connecter.<\/li>\n<\/ol>\n\n\n\n<h3 class=\"wp-block-heading\" id=\"h-activez-le-bluetooth-sur-votre-brique-ev3\">Activez le Bluetooth sur votre brique EV3<\/h3>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Allumez votre brique EV3 en maintenant le bouton central appuy\u00e9 quelques secondes.<\/li>\n\n\n\n<li>Avec les fl\u00e8ches directionnelles, s\u00e9lectionnez l\u2019onglet param\u00e8tres situ\u00e9 \u00e0 droite de l\u2019\u00e9cran (1).<\/li>\n\n\n\n<li>S\u00e9lectionnez \u00ab\u00a0Bluetooth\u00a0\u00bb \u00e0 l&rsquo;aide des boutons Haut et Bas (2), puis appuyez sur le bouton central pour confirmer. La case Bluetooth est coch\u00e9e. Le Bluetooth est maintenant activ\u00e9 sur la brique EV3 et une ic\u00f4ne Bluetooth s&rsquo;affiche dans le coin sup\u00e9rieur gauche de l&rsquo;\u00e9cran.<\/li>\n<\/ol>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ter\"><a href=\"https:\/\/blog.generationrobots.com\/wp-content\/uploads\/2019\/07\/activation-bluetooth-brique-EV3.jpg\"><img fetchpriority=\"high\" decoding=\"async\" width=\"800\" height=\"427\" src=\"https:\/\/blog.generationrobots.com\/wp-content\/uploads\/2019\/07\/activation-bluetooth-brique-EV3.jpg\" alt=\"Activez le Bluetooth sur votre brique EV3\" class=\"wp-image-5903\" srcset=\"https:\/\/www.generationrobots.com\/blog\/wp-content\/uploads\/2019\/07\/activation-bluetooth-brique-EV3.jpg 800w, https:\/\/www.generationrobots.com\/blog\/wp-content\/uploads\/2019\/07\/activation-bluetooth-brique-EV3-300x160.jpg 300w, https:\/\/www.generationrobots.com\/blog\/wp-content\/uploads\/2019\/07\/activation-bluetooth-brique-EV3-768x410.jpg 768w\" sizes=\"(max-width: 800px) 100vw, 800px\" \/><\/a><\/figure><\/div>\n\n\n<h2 class=\"wp-block-heading\" id=\"h-connectez-votre-brique-ev3-a-l-editeur-scratch-3\">Connectez votre brique EV3 \u00e0 l\u2019\u00e9diteur Scratch 3<\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Ouvrez l\u2019<a class=\"catalogue\" title=\"Editeur de code Scratch 3\" href=\"https:\/\/scratch.mit.edu\/projects\/editor\/?tutorial=getStarted\" target=\"_blank\" rel=\"noopener noreferrer\">\u00e9diteur Scratch 3<\/a> dans un navigateur web<\/li>\n\n\n\n<li>Cliquez sur l\u2019ic\u00f4ne Extensions, en bas \u00e0 gauche de l\u2019\u00e9cran<\/li>\n\n\n\n<li>Une fois dans la liste des extensions disponibles, s\u00e9lectionnez l\u2019extension Lego Mindstorms.<\/li>\n\n\n\n<li>Connectez l\u2019\u00e9diteur Scratch \u00e0 votre brique EV3 (1) (si celle-ci n\u2019appara\u00eet pas, v\u00e9rifiez que le Bluetooth est bien activ\u00e9 sur la brique et sur l\u2019ordinateur).<\/li>\n\n\n\n<li>Acceptez la connexion sur la brique EV3 manuellement, puis saisissez le mot de passe et appuyez sur le bouton central pour confirmer. Le mot de passe par d\u00e9faut est 1234. (manipulation \u00e0 faire rapidement, au risque de perdre la connexion entre les deux)<\/li>\n\n\n\n<li>Validez la connexion depuis l\u2019\u00e9diteur Scratch 3 (2).<\/li>\n\n\n\n<li>Si la connexion a bien \u00e9t\u00e9 faite entre l\u2019\u00e9diteur et la brique EV3, une fen\u00eatre de confirmation apparaitra (3).<\/li>\n\n\n\n<li>Retournez sur l\u2019\u00e9diteur Scratch 3, un tutoriel en vid\u00e9o sur Scratch 3 et Lego Mindstorms se lance automatiquement sur l\u2019espace de travail.<\/li>\n<\/ol>\n\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ter\"><a href=\"https:\/\/blog.generationrobots.com\/wp-content\/uploads\/2019\/07\/scratch-3-editeur-bouton-ajouter-extension.jpg\"><img decoding=\"async\" width=\"920\" height=\"441\" src=\"https:\/\/blog.generationrobots.com\/wp-content\/uploads\/2019\/07\/scratch-3-editeur-bouton-ajouter-extension.jpg\" alt=\"Ajouter l'extension Lego Mindstorms sur Scratch 3\" class=\"wp-image-5904\" srcset=\"https:\/\/www.generationrobots.com\/blog\/wp-content\/uploads\/2019\/07\/scratch-3-editeur-bouton-ajouter-extension.jpg 920w, https:\/\/www.generationrobots.com\/blog\/wp-content\/uploads\/2019\/07\/scratch-3-editeur-bouton-ajouter-extension-300x144.jpg 300w, https:\/\/www.generationrobots.com\/blog\/wp-content\/uploads\/2019\/07\/scratch-3-editeur-bouton-ajouter-extension-768x368.jpg 768w\" sizes=\"(max-width: 920px) 100vw, 920px\" \/><\/a><\/figure><\/div>\n\n<div class=\"wp-block-image\">\n<figure class=\"aligncenter\"><a href=\"https:\/\/blog.generationrobots.com\/wp-content\/uploads\/2019\/07\/connexion-scratch-3-brique-ev3.jpg\"><img decoding=\"async\" width=\"762\" height=\"493\" src=\"https:\/\/blog.generationrobots.com\/wp-content\/uploads\/2019\/07\/connexion-scratch-3-brique-ev3.jpg\" alt=\"Connectez votre brique EV3 \u00e0 l\u2019\u00e9diteur Scratch 3\" class=\"wp-image-5898\" srcset=\"https:\/\/www.generationrobots.com\/blog\/wp-content\/uploads\/2019\/07\/connexion-scratch-3-brique-ev3.jpg 762w, https:\/\/www.generationrobots.com\/blog\/wp-content\/uploads\/2019\/07\/connexion-scratch-3-brique-ev3-300x194.jpg 300w\" sizes=\"(max-width: 762px) 100vw, 762px\" \/><\/a><\/figure><\/div>\n\n\n<h2 class=\"wp-block-heading\" id=\"h-premier-pas-avec-scratch-3-pour-lego-mindstorms\">Premier pas avec Scratch 3 pour Lego Mindstorms<\/h2>\n\n\n\n<p>Il existe <a class=\"catalogue\" title=\"L'extension Lego Mindstorms pour Scratch 3\" href=\"https:\/\/en.scratch-wiki.info\/wiki\/LEGO_MINDSTORMS_EV3_Extension\" target=\"_blank\" rel=\"noopener noreferrer\">11 blocs Scratch pour Lego Mindstorms<\/a>, qu\u2019il est possible de m\u00e9langer avec les blocs classiques de l\u2019\u00e9diteur Scratch 3.<\/p>\n\n\n\n<p>Ci-dessous, nous vous expliquons comment cr\u00e9er un petit programme de test, qui vous permettra de v\u00e9rifier que tout fonctionne correctement.<\/p>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Branchez un capteur tactile Lego Mindstorms EV3 sur le port 1 de votre brique EV3.<\/li>\n\n\n\n<li>Dans l\u2019\u00e9diteur Scratch, g\u00e9n\u00e9rez un nouveau sprite \u00ab batterie \u00bb (il se trouve dans la cat\u00e9gorie \u00ab musique \u00bb). Supprimez le sprite du chat Scratch.<\/li>\n\n\n\n<li>Dans les blocs \u00ab Lego EV3 \u00bb (situ\u00e9s tout en bas de la biblioth\u00e8que de blocs Scratch), s\u00e9lectionnez le bloc \u00ab Quand le bouton 1 est appuy\u00e9 \u00bb. Dans la cat\u00e9gorie \u00ab Son \u00bb, choisissez le bloc \u00ab Drum Bass1 \u00bb<\/li>\n\n\n\n<li>Lancez votre programme en cliquant sur le drapeau vert et appuyez sur le bouton de votre capteur tactile Lego EV3.<\/li>\n<\/ol>\n\n\n\n<p><strong>Que se passe-t-il alors ? (attention, vous aurez besoin de haut-parleurs ou d\u2019\u00e9couteurs branch\u00e9s \u00e0 votre ordinateur pour r\u00e9aliser cette exp\u00e9rience !)<\/strong><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Dans ce tutoriel, vous apprendrez comment programmer vos Lego Mindstorms avec le logiciel Scratch 3. Il est \u00e9galement possible d\u2019utiliser Scratch 3 avec les Lego Boost et les Lego WeDo. Pr\u00e9requis \u00e0 l\u2019utilisation de Scratch 3 avec Lego Mindstorms : les logiciels Pr\u00e9requis \u00e0 l\u2019utilisation de Scratch 3 avec Lego Mindstorms : le bluetooth Activez[&#8230;]<br \/> <a class=\"button\" href=\"https:\/\/www.generationrobots.com\/blog\/fr\/comment-programmer-des-lego-mindstorms-ev3-avec-scratch-3\/\" style=\"float:right;\">Read this article &gt;&gt;<\/a><\/p>\n","protected":false},"author":188,"featured_media":5896,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1128],"tags":[],"class_list":["post-5893","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-education"],"_links":{"self":[{"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/posts\/5893","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/users\/188"}],"replies":[{"embeddable":true,"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/comments?post=5893"}],"version-history":[{"count":7,"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/posts\/5893\/revisions"}],"predecessor-version":[{"id":13199,"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/posts\/5893\/revisions\/13199"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/media\/5896"}],"wp:attachment":[{"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/media?parent=5893"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/categories?post=5893"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.generationrobots.com\/blog\/wp-json\/wp\/v2\/tags?post=5893"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}